    While previous research has shown that during mental imagery participants look back to areas visited during encoding it is unclear what happens when information presented during encoding is incongruent. To investigate this research question, we presented 30 participants with incongruent audio-visual associations (e.g. the image of a car paired with the sound of a cat) and later asked them to create a congruent mental representation based on the auditory cue (e.g. to create a mental representation of a cat while hearing the sound of a cat). The results revealed that participants spent more time in the areas where they previously saw the object and that incongruent audio-visual information during encoding did not appear to interfere with the generation and maintenance of mental images. This finding suggests that eye movements can be flexibly employed during mental imagery depending on the demands of the task.

    This study expands on previous SLA research by focusing on learning collocational rules. The study also explores the interaction between exposure conditions, awareness, and item-related variables in the context of collocation learning. Chinese learners of English were exposed to sentences from large corpora, featuring four target node verbs (replaced with pseudowords) and their respective noun collocates. There are two pairs of novel verbs with different L1-L2 congruencies in the experimental material. Participants were divided into incidental and intentional groups. The learning effectiveness was assessed through a plausibility judgment test (PJT), which included trained, new, and swapped items. Awareness of the underlying rules was measured using source attributions, retrospective verbal reports, and posttest thinking aloud. The results revealed that participants acquired both explicit and implicit knowledge of collocational rules. Rule-searching led to greater explicit knowledge but did not improve overall learning outcomes. Additionally, an interaction was observed among awareness, rule type, and test type. As the difficulty level increased in terms of L1-L2 congruency or item type, the importance of awareness in meeting the learning demands also increased.
